South Korea lifts ban: Golden opportunity for Nghe An workers

Thanh Nga January 19, 2024 20:05

(Baonghean.vn) - On this occasion, 3 localities of Nghe An, Nghi Loc, Cua Lo, Hung Nguyen, which were previously banned from sending workers to Korea, have just received official letters agreeing to recruit workers from Korea. These are good signs for Nghe An workers in a potential market like Korea.

Opportunities for Nghe An workers

The Overseas Labor Center has just issued Official Dispatch No. 1064/TTLĐNN-TCLĐ on coordinating the organization of labor recruitment under the EPS Program, Phase 1, 2024. Accordingly, Nghe An is one of four provinces whose localities were previously banned and are now allowed to participate in this recruitment.

Korea will recruit 15,300 people in 4 industries. Of these, there are 11,200 positions in the manufacturing industry, nearly 900 in agriculture, 200 in construction, and more than 3,000 in the fisheries industry. This is considered a good opportunity for workers in Cua Lo, Nghi Loc, and Hung Nguyen towns, who have not had the opportunity to go to Korea to work for many years.

Upon receiving this information, Hung Nguyen district sent a dispatch to communes with a large number of workers of working age and in need of exporting labor. Mr. Nguyen Xuan Hiep - Head of the Department of Labor, War Invalids and Social Affairs of Hung Nguyen district said: Currently, we have 18,000 - 20,000 workers working in European and Asian markets, of which 1,000 - 1,200 workers are working in Korea as international students or E7. In 2023, many workers in Korea whose visas have expired have returned to their localities, thanks to which workers who are at home have the opportunity to access this program. Mr. Hiep also said that currently, 1,000 workers in the district are registering to study Korean and orient themselves at the Provincial Employment Service Center to prepare documents in time for the first recruitment round.

Hung Linh Commune, Hung Nguyen District currently has 500 workers working abroad, of which 60 are working in Korea. Mr. Nguyen Van Que - a commune policy officer said: "This time, the commune has 80 people attending Korean language classes to prepare for the recruitment exam. These are skilled workers who have been trained in many companies and businesses in the area, many of whom have even worked in markets such as Taiwan and the Middle East. The locality will create the best conditions, find loan sources and cooperate with the Provincial Employment Service Center to help workers have the best preparation."

Cua Lo town used to be a locality with a large number of workers working and residing in Korea. According to statistics, as of March 2023, there were 212 workers in the town residing illegally in Korea. However, by the end of the year, most of these workers had returned home. Mr. Nguyen Thanh Minh - Head of the Department of Labor, War Invalids and Social Affairs of Cua Lo town said: Through many measures including propaganda and cooperation from the other side, many illegal workers from Cua Lo town have returned home, creating opportunities to access this high-income market for workers at home. According to a survey, Cua Lo town currently has nearly 2,000 workers who want to go to Korea to work.

Commitment not to reside illegally

As of March 31, 2023, Nghe An province currently has 2,311 workers residing illegally in Korea. Recently, the Department of Labor, War Invalids and Social Affairs has coordinated to organize many activities and forms of mobilizing workers to return home according to regulations. Localities directly work with families with workers, and at the same time do not confirm the records and necessary procedures and papers of workers who register to work in Korea when these workers have siblings residing illegally in this country...

After a period of persistent propaganda and mobilization, the number of illegal workers has decreased significantly. By the end of December 2023, 3 localities, Hung Nguyen, Nghi Loc, and Cua Lo Town, were officially announced by Korea to have the ban lifted. "These localities are recorded to have a number of illegal workers residing lower than 70 people, and a high rate of returning home after their contracts have expired," said Mr. Tran Phi Hung - Head of the Department of Labor Safety and Employment,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s.

Mr. Vo Chi Cong, in Trung Thanh block, Nghi Hai ward, Cua Lo town, used to work in Korea under the commercial program, which means he took a direct exam with the company on the other side for a period of 1 year. Cong was recruited in the construction industry and had a good income, but he still strictly followed the contract term and returned home after 1 year of working in the land of Kim Chi. In early 2024, upon receiving information that Korea was recruiting workers under the EPS program, Cong immediately registered and is attending a Korean language class organized by the Provincial Employment Service Center.

Cong said: “Korea lifting the ban is a stroke of luck for us workers, and to be able to return to Korea this time, the entire political system must participate in propagating for illegal workers to return home. So, to give my brothers and sisters the opportunity to go to Korea in the future, I pledge to return home on time.”

Vice Chairman of Nghi Hai Ward, Cua Lo Town - Le Ngoc Minh said: Currently, the locality has about 181 people residing in Korea and most of them are workers still under contract for studying abroad, or E7, so the workers who pass the upcoming EPS recruitment will have special commitments to ensure compliance within the 4 years and 10 months period as stipulated in the EPS contract.

According to Official Dispatch No. 1064/TTLĐNN-TCLĐ on coordination in organizing the selection of workers under the EPS Program, workers participating in this recruitment exam must have never been deported from Korea. If they have ever resided in Korea, including legal and illegal residence under Visa E9 (EPS workers) or (and) visa E10 (fishing boat crew), the residence period must be less than 5 years; workers are not banned from leaving Vietnam; and have no relatives residing illegally in Korea.
In case the worker has gone to work in Korea under the EPS Program, he/she must return to his/her home country on time as per the contract. In case he/she has resided illegally in Korea, he/she must voluntarily return to his/her home country during the period when the Korean Government implemented the policy of exempting penalties for illegal residents who voluntarily present themselves to return to their home country. The program of sending workers to work under fixed-term contracts in Korea under the EPS Program is a non-profit program registered in cooperation between the Government of Vietnam and Korea. Nghe An Provincial Employment Service Center is the only unit assigned by the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s to perform employment tasks in Nghe An. This is also the only unit assigned by the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s to participate in performing tasks related to the EPS Program, including receiving documents and collecting fees according to regulations, specifically: For workers who pass the exam and are selected by Korean enterprises, the participation fee must be 630 USD, or nearly 14,700,000 VND, and a deposit of 100 million VND against evasion at the Social Policy Bank where the worker resides.
